The waiting game continues for the Celtics as we enter the final three days of the regular season, with three potential first-round opponents still in play. Currently, the Bucks and Heat are tied for the No. 6 seed with a 43-37, but the Heat hold the head-to-head tiebreaker which pushes the Bucks to the No. 7 spot for the time being. The Wizards are all alone in eighth place, a game behind Miami and Milwaukee with a 42-38 record after dropping their last four games.

Head-to-head tiebreakers


  • Heat over Bucks (3-0)

  • Wizards over Bucks (2-2 head-to-head, but Wizards win via conference record)

  • Heat over Wizards (2-2 head-to-head, but Heat win divisional record, which would be eventual tiebreaker)  


Three way-tiebreaker


  • 1. Heat, 2. Wizards, 3. Bucks (Based on head-to-head matchups)

ANALYSIS/SCENARIOS


If the Heat win and Bucks lose on Monday, the Heat clinch the No. 6 seed.

Heat finish with No. 7 seed if 


  • Heat go 0-2, Bucks go 1-1 (or better) and Wizards go 0-2

  • Heat go 1-1 and Bucks go 2-0.


Bucks finish with No. 7 seed if


  • Bucks go 2-0 and Heat go 2-0

  • Bucks go 1-1, Heat go 1-1 and Wizards finish 1-1 or 0-2

  • Bucks go 0-2 and Wizards go 0-2


Wizards finish with No. 7 seed if 


  • Wizards go 2-0, Bucks go 1-1 (or worse) and Heat finish 1-1 or 2-0

  • Wizards go 1-1 and Bucks go 0-2
